For example, MotoGP bikes can accelerate just as quickly to 100 km/h, and there are a few other types of race cars that could easily ... cannot be ill cannot be good techniqueWeb1 feb. 2024 · A Formula 1 car never races twice. The relentless pace of improvement, and the ever-changing demands of 22 unique circuits ensure any particular arrangement of bodywork and mechanical underpinnings is ephemeral at best. From race to race the car always changes – but more than this, it also changes session to session. cannot be held responsible disclaimer
